Photo GalleryEAST STROUDSBURG - Freshman outside hitter
Erin Gloor had 12 kills and senior outside hitter
Abby Welch added nine as East Stroudsburg University notched a 3-0 win over Cheyney in PSAC East women's volleyball on Tuesday night at Koehler Fieldhouse.
Freshman middle blocker
Sarah Fillman added eight kills for ESU (6-12, 2-8), which won by set scores of 25-12, 25-21 and 25-19.
Gloor and Fillman both had season-highs in kills and freshman outside
Rosa Veliky had four kills and a season-high 11 digs.
Senior setter
Annabelle Charlton had five kills, 18 assists and seven digs. Freshman setter
Erica Cunningham had 12 assists, sophomore setter
Abby Koval had eight assists and junior middle blocker
Megan Braunagel added four kills on four attacks.
Breanna Joseph and Katherine Brooks both had six kills for Cheyney (1-15, 0-10).
ESU travels to western PA for PSAC crossover action this weekend. The Warriors will face Clarion (16-1, 8-1) and Seton Hill (16-2, 7-2) on Friday at Clarion, and IUP (5-11, 2-7) and California (13-5, 7-2) on Saturday at IUP.
